So, while your highest tax bracket would be 24 percent in this example, your income would be taxed at an average rate of 18.6 percent. FS-2024-6, April 2024. The U.S. tax system operates on a pay-as-you-go basis. This means that taxpayers need to pay most of their tax during the year, as the income is earned or received. Web1 de dez. de 2024 · Tax laws are the legal rules and procedures governing how federal, state and local governments calculate the tax you owe. The laws cover income, corporate, excise, luxury, estate and property taxes, to name just a few.
